What Are Kidney Stones?
Kidney stones are hard mineral and salt deposits that form inside the kidneys. They develop when urine becomes concentrated, allowing minerals like calcium, oxalate, and uric acid to crystallize and stick together.
Stones can vary in size — from tiny grains to large stones that block the urinary tract.
Common Causes of Kidney Stones
Several factors can increase the risk of kidney stone formation:
Low water intake (dehydration)
High salt or high protein diet
Excessive consumption of oxalate-rich foods
Family history of kidney stones
Obesity
Certain medical conditions like gout
Lack of proper hydration is one of the leading causes in India, especially in hot climates.
Types of Kidney Stones
Understanding the type of stone helps determine the best treatment approach.
1. Calcium Stones
The most common type, usually formed from calcium oxalate.
2. Uric Acid Stones
Often linked to high-protein diets and gout.
3. Struvite Stones
Typically caused by urinary tract infections.
4. Cystine Stones
Rare and usually hereditary.
Symptoms of Kidney Stones
Kidney stones may not show symptoms until they move into the ureter. Common signs include:
Severe pain in the back or side
Pain during urination
Blood in urine
Frequent urge to urinate
Nausea and vomiting
Fever (if infection is present)
The pain is often described as sharp and intense, sometimes called renal colic.

Advanced Kidney Stone Treatment Options
Modern urology offers multiple treatment options depending on the size and location of the stone.
1. Medication
Small stones may pass naturally with proper hydration and prescribed medication to reduce pain and relax the ureter.
2. ESWL (Shock Wave Therapy)
Extracorporeal Shock Wave Lithotripsy uses sound waves to break stones into smaller pieces so they can pass naturally.
3. URS (Ureteroscopy)
A thin scope is inserted through the urinary tract to remove or break the stone using laser technology.
4. PCNL (Percutaneous Nephrolithotomy)
Used for larger stones, this minimally invasive surgery removes stones through a small incision in the back.
Choosing the right treatment depends on stone size, type, patient health condition, and recurrence history.

How to Prevent Kidney Stones
Prevention plays a major role in avoiding recurrence.
Drink 2.5–3 liters of water daily
Reduce salt intake
Avoid excessive red meat
Maintain healthy weight
Limit processed foods
Follow doctor-recommended diet plan
Dietary adjustments can greatly reduce future risk.

Diagnosis Process
To determine the correct treatment, doctors may recommend:
Ultrasound
CT scan
Urine analysis
Blood tests
These tests help evaluate stone size, location, and underlying cause.
Recovery After Treatment
Recovery time depends on the procedure performed. Most minimally invasive treatments allow patients to resume normal activities within a few days.
Following medical advice, staying hydrated, and regular follow-ups are essential for complete recovery.
